Transaction e524bf10b94cb9474affc3c066f7a70fcda519a763f2e57f62e39227e499cdfc
1 Input
2 Outputs
- e524bf10b94cb9474affc3c066f7a70fcda519a763f2e57f62e39227e499cdfc:0
- e524bf10b94cb9474affc3c066f7a70fcda519a763f2e57f62e39227e499cdfc:1
value 384340257
address 3JeWxieDftRmySVudQTFVRSwExGy4e7p4j
value 90000
address 34zLpawBmHBdsSKdqAnk7nEjrP1iDagSdm